The following code compiles with neither gfortran-11 nor gfortran-12, but does
compile with gfortran-10 and earlier. The error message just says "(null):0:
confused by earlier errors, bailing out" without giving any indication what the
problem is. (The actual problem seems to be the clash between the variable name
'p' in the common block and the module name 'p'.)

MODULE commons
   IMPLICIT NONE
   INTEGER :: p
   COMMON /c/ p
END
MODULE p
   IMPLICIT NONE
   SAVE
   CONTAINS
   SUBROUTINE sub
   USE commons
   END SUBROUTINE sub
END

$ gfortran-11 -c code.f90 

(null):0: confused by earlier errors, bailing out
